  • Techno Frontier Exhibition, Japan 2015

    Making inroads into the market in Japan

    At this year’s Techno Frontier exhibition in Tokyo metropolitan area, Trinamic made considerable headway with its strong lead in advanced and highly scalable motion control technologies that were presented by Trinamic’s distribution partner NDK Semiconductor at the Makuhari venue, 20.-22. May 2015.

    Trinamic’s stealthChop technology that drives stepper motors at a super silent level was particularly well received, opening doors for more business in Japan, as well as strengthening ties especially with business partners in robotics, CCTV, medical and supported living technologies.

    At the exhibition, exceedingly small, dense, scalable and low-noise solutions were particularly sought after, reflecting today’s miniaturization trend that is driving technology inventions world-wide and calling for business synergies for integrated solutions.

    Trinamic could strengthen its cooperation with NDK Semiconductor, and is pleased to be going strong together.

    Techno Frontier is a leading electronic and mechatronic device and components exhibition in Asia, with exhibitors from Japan, China, Korea, Taiwan and Europe – attracting about 32 000 professionals and several thousand visitors per year.
